I did not mean to triple post, i am just getting very frustrated with my car. This is my first audi ever and things have not been smooth at all.

My car is not giving a check engine light one and not even a single freaking code. I was advised to change the mass air flow sensor, which I did, and nothing has change.

The only things i have done in my car was upgrade to KO4 and a unitronic chip. I drove amazingly nice for a couple of days, and then one day as I was merging on to the freeway the car hesitate like it was not getting gas and slowly the power started to go away.

Try unplugging the battery for 15-30 mins and see what happens. Its tricky when you dont have fault codes to work with. You saying a 5 bar fpr, or any change to fueling is NOT recomended to use with the k04 unitronics chip? I would find that hard to believe. Not sure how long youve had the chip.. Most places have an unconditional 30 day money back gaurantee. Maybe take advantage of that (if you can)and go with GIAC. You dont hear any odd noises or anything other than its just lost power? Do you have a boost gauge?

10 mins is fine. When you plug it back in, turn your car ON not START. YOu will hear a high pitch whine (tb reseting), when it stops, you can start the car.
